The Advantage of Fixed Pricing and Transparency
Transparency is where private transfers truly shine. A trip from Zurich Airport to Lucerne, for example, typically costs around 180 CHF with a reputable provider-no surprises. This fixed rate covers everything: tolls, fuel, and even waiting time due to flight delays. Compare that to a conventional taxi, where the same journey could spike significantly during peak hours or at night. With public transport, while cheaper, you’re trading cost for convenience, often requiring multiple transfers and extra effort with heavy bags.
| ✅ Service Type | ⏱️ Waiting Time | 🚪 Door-to-Door Delivery | 📊 Price Predictability |
|---|---|---|---|
| Private Transfers | Driver monitors flight; waits at no extra cost | Yes, direct to your address | Fixed rate confirmed at booking |
| Standard Taxis | Variable; may charge while waiting | Yes, but meter runs continuously | Unpredictable; surge pricing possible |
| Public Trains | Fixed schedules; no flight tracking | No; requires walking or local transit | Fixed per ticket, but extra for luggage or zones |

Convenience and 24/7 Availability
Public transit in Switzerland is efficient during peak hours, but its coverage thins out after midnight. If your flight lands at 2 a.m., you’ll find few options beyond a taxi-often at a premium. Private transfers eliminate that gap, offering the same reliable service regardless of the hour. This is especially valuable for international business travelers or those connecting from long-haul flights with unpredictable schedules.

Client Questions
What happens to my fare if my flight to ZRH is significantly delayed?
Most private transfer services include real-time flight tracking and offer free waiting time, so delays won’t result in additional charges. Your driver adjusts automatically and waits for you at no extra cost, ensuring a stress-free arrival regardless of your flight’s schedule.
Are there shared shuttle alternatives if I am traveling solo on a tight budget?
Yes, shared shuttles are a more affordable option for solo travelers. While they lack the privacy and direct routing of a private transfer, they still offer door-to-door convenience and are more comfortable than public trains. However, they may involve multiple stops and longer travel times.
If I need a last-minute change to my destination after landing, is it possible?
Depending on the provider, last-minute changes can often be accommodated-especially with hourly booking packages. Direct communication with the dispatch center allows for route adjustments, making it easier to adapt to unexpected plans while still avoiding the hassle of public transit or car rentals.
